SUBLETTE – The profits generated from the Sublette Farm Toy and Antique Tractor Show are all invested back into the area. Three scholarships are awarded to FFA members from the Amboy and Mendota FFA chapters, as well as to the 4-H members from the Sublette and Maytown 4-H clubs.

Winners of this year’s scholarships are Zach Becker, Amboy FFA Scholarship; Marie Barnickel, Mendota FFA Scholarship; Grace Klein, Maytown Comets 4-H Scholarship. Also, Owen Wixom of Mendota won the Max Armstrong Scholarship.

Funds are also donated to local schools, churches, the fire department and other worthy charities around the community. Youth activities around Sublette are also funded by the proceeds.

The pancake breakfast sponsored by the Sublette Volunteer Fire Department also generates funds for purchasing equipment for the local fire and ambulance service. This is a major fundraiser for the department each year.
